Stop Carbon Monoxide Poisoning

Carbon monoxide is a transparent and scentless substance generated when propellants is not completely burned. A clogged or unclean chimney might block proper CO discharge, enabling it to gather within the residence. Increased amounts of CO within the atmosphere may be excessively dangerous, even fatal. Regular flue cleanings have the potential to aid ensure no zero impediments or barriers that could cause CO buildup, consequently ensuring your loved ones safe.

Cover Your Chimney

Secure your chimney whenever you're not using the fireplace. A cap is normally made of stainless steel that resists rust, stopping oxidation. This cap is designed with the goal of stop animals, dirt, and plant matter from clogging the normal gas.

Monterey (/ˌmɒntəˈreɪ/ i; Spanish: Monterrey) is a city located in Monterey County on the southern edge of Monterey Bay on the U.S. state of California's Central Coast. Founded on June 3, 1770, it functioned as the capital of Alta California under both Spain (1804–1821) and Mexico (1822–1846). During this period, Monterey hosted California's first theater, public building, public library, publicly funded school, printing-press, and newspaper. It was originally the only port of entry for all taxable goods in California. In 1846, during the Mexican–American War of 1846–1848, the United States Flag was raised over the Customs House. After Mexico ceded California to the U.S. at the end of the war, Monterey hosted California's first constitutional convention in 1849.
